Well, first thing you need to do is send them a written request to cease all communication with you. If you wish you can send them a copy of the release of liability. As far as taking civil action, I suppose you might be able to push fdcpa violation as you no longer have any association with the person in question. Unless you already have a attorney in mind that has knowledge of the FDCPA then I would suggest referencing naca.net as a good start.

Be sure you get a consultation first to make sure you have a case.
